I live in a drafty concrete building. There is an interior wall that is damp, sometimes gets molding etc. I attempted to paint it another colour besides white but it really emphasized the imperfections so I am now thinking about using the wallpaper that looks like paint. Anyway, is it a bad idea to use wall paper on a damp wall that tends to mold?

Just a year ago, I would say yes. Now, I will tell you that you can. The products that make this possible are mildew-proof primer and adhesives and wallcovering that is very resistant to mildew due to it's breatheability.

The primer and adhesive you should use is by Zinsser.
http://www.zinsser.com/product_detail.asp?ProductID=73

The wallpaper TYPE (not to be confused with pattern or appearance) is the new non-woven type. This is made by several manufacturers to include:

There may be other manufacturers out there as well because non-wovens are catching on here. They have been out for years in Europe.

I recommend you ask for them at a wallpaper store or paint store with a dedicated wallpaper associate. SPECIFY non-woven wallpaper to the associate. Non-woven refers to the substrate that the paper is made of. Expect resistance from your retailer due to the recent marketing of these wallpapers. You might even print this page out as a reminder.
